Where to invest $50k to earn a decent % return?



I've been investing in prosper for about 5 years now and it has become 100x better in the last 2 years for one reason: market place - which allows you to sell your current notes.

Before the market place when you invested in a loan you were stuck for 3 years(unless the borrower prepaid).

Now with the market place you are able to list your loans for sale to the highest bidder. I generally invest a few $k every 6 months. Collect 3 months worth of payments and list them all for sale until they're gone.

I know it seems counterproductive to list and sell list and sell but that's the kind of person I am - I don't like sitting still. PLUS if you need to liquidate everything, you can generally get all your cash back within 2 weeks.

For best results invest in shorter (1 or 3 year) loans, small amounts ($25-$50) and higher/riskier rates(20%+). These seem to be the easiest loans to unload in the market place as most other investors shy away from 5 year/low yield notes.

I've been pretty happy with Lending Club returns with a Prime account, which just means they manage your account for you based on the risk and terms you specify. Those are 3-5 year notes, but they have a marketplace to sell them if you need to cash out (although I'm not sure how active it is). Spread your risk... maybe put $10k there, 30k in Munies, $10k in a new business venture.
